[發(fā)明專利]圖像處理裝置、調(diào)試支援方法以及記錄有調(diào)試支援程序的計(jì)算機(jī)可讀取的記錄介質(zhì)在審
| 申請(qǐng)?zhí)枺?/td> | 201710483109.9 | 申請(qǐng)日: | 2017-06-23 |
| 公開(公告)號(hào): | CN107544833A | 公開(公告)日: | 2018-01-05 |
| 發(fā)明(設(shè)計(jì))人: | 大迫了敏;上田滋之;細(xì)野真央 | 申請(qǐng)(專利權(quán))人: | 柯尼卡美能達(dá)株式會(huì)社 |
| 主分類號(hào): | G06F9/455 | 分類號(hào): | G06F9/455;G06F11/14 |
| 代理公司: | 中國(guó)國(guó)際貿(mào)易促進(jìn)委員會(huì)專利商標(biāo)事務(wù)所11038 | 代理人: | 張麗 |
| 地址: | 日本*** | 國(guó)省代碼: | 暫無(wú)信息 |
| 權(quán)利要求書: | 查看更多 | 說(shuō)明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 圖像 處理 裝置 調(diào)試 支援 方法 以及 記錄 程序 計(jì)算機(jī) 讀取 介質(zhì) | ||
技術(shù)領(lǐng)域
本發(fā)明涉及圖像處理裝置、調(diào)試支援方法以及記錄有調(diào)試支援程序的計(jì)算機(jī)可讀取的記錄介質(zhì),特別涉及安裝有多個(gè)操作系統(tǒng)的圖像處理裝置、通過(guò)該圖像處理裝置執(zhí)行的調(diào)試支援方法以及記錄有調(diào)試支援程序的計(jì)算機(jī)可讀取的記錄介質(zhì)。
背景技術(shù)
由處理圖像的圖像處理裝置所代表的MFP(Multi Function Peripheral,多功能復(fù)合機(jī))搭載有各種硬件資源,通過(guò)CPU控制這些硬件資源。硬件資源例如是用于處理圖像數(shù)據(jù)的ASIC(Application Specific Integrated Circuit,專用集成電路)、在紙張上形成圖像的引擎等。另外,在MFP安裝有應(yīng)用程序,并存在該應(yīng)用程序包括對(duì)硬件資源進(jìn)行控制的處理的情況。在開發(fā)這樣的應(yīng)用程序的階段,需要使對(duì)由應(yīng)用程序規(guī)定的硬件資源進(jìn)行控制的處理與硬件資源的動(dòng)作匹配。特別是在多個(gè)應(yīng)用程序控制一個(gè)硬件資源的情況下,有時(shí)發(fā)生由控制競(jìng)爭(zhēng)所致的出錯(cuò)。在該情況下,有在實(shí)際完成應(yīng)用程序的階段執(zhí)行應(yīng)用程序來(lái)檢查與硬件資源的動(dòng)作的匹配性的方法。
然而,在從應(yīng)用程序控制硬件資源起至從硬件資源有響應(yīng)為止的期間存在出錯(cuò)的原因的情況下,從控制硬件資源起至有響應(yīng)為止的期間短,所以存在發(fā)生出錯(cuò)的概率低以致難以確定出錯(cuò)的原因的問(wèn)題。例如,在日本特開2013-012196號(hào)公報(bào)中記載有如下技術(shù):一種用于通過(guò)目標(biāo)硬件平臺(tái)執(zhí)行的軟件應(yīng)用所執(zhí)行的方法,決定目標(biāo)硬件平臺(tái)的硬件描述語(yǔ)言(HDL)的描述,根據(jù)HDL描述來(lái)構(gòu)成與目標(biāo)硬件平臺(tái)在功能上等價(jià)的可編程硬件組件。然而,即使應(yīng)用日本特開2013-012196號(hào)公報(bào)所記載的方法,也必須構(gòu)成使ASIC的響應(yīng)延遲的規(guī)格的可編程硬件組件,從為了構(gòu)成這樣的規(guī)格的可編程硬件組件而花費(fèi)的成本來(lái)看是不現(xiàn)實(shí)的。
專利文獻(xiàn)1:日本特開2013-012196號(hào)公報(bào)
發(fā)明內(nèi)容
本發(fā)明是為了解決上述問(wèn)題而完成的,本發(fā)明的目的之一在于提供一種能夠不變更硬件資源而再現(xiàn)變更了硬件資源的動(dòng)作的狀態(tài)的圖像處理裝置。
本發(fā)明的另一目的在于提供一種能夠不變更硬件資源而再現(xiàn)變更了硬件資源的動(dòng)作的狀態(tài)的調(diào)試支援方法。
本發(fā)明的又一目的在于提供一種能夠不變更硬件資源而再現(xiàn)變更了硬件資源的動(dòng)作的狀態(tài)的調(diào)試支援程序。
為了達(dá)到上述目的,根據(jù)本發(fā)明的某個(gè)方案,涉及圖像處理裝置,具備:主控制單元,執(zhí)行操作系統(tǒng)程序來(lái)控制硬件資源;客控制單元,執(zhí)行與操作系統(tǒng)程序相同的操作系統(tǒng)程序;仿真單元,設(shè)置于主控制單元與客控制單元之間,能夠通過(guò)客控制單元控制硬件資源;以及變更單元,變更HDL程序,該HDL程序用硬件描述語(yǔ)言描述硬件資源能夠執(zhí)行的處理,客控制單元包括客驅(qū)動(dòng)單元,該客驅(qū)動(dòng)單元為了控制硬件資源而執(zhí)行驅(qū)動(dòng)程序,仿真單元包括:設(shè)備仿真單元,通過(guò)執(zhí)行變更后的HDL程序?qū)τ布Y源進(jìn)行仿真;以及切換單元,切換為第一控制和第二控制中的某一個(gè)控制,在該第一控制中依照客驅(qū)動(dòng)單元對(duì)硬件資源的控制來(lái)控制主控制單元以控制硬件資源,在該第二控制中依照客驅(qū)動(dòng)單元對(duì)硬件資源的控制來(lái)控制設(shè)備仿真單元。
根據(jù)該方案,變更用硬件描述語(yǔ)言描述硬件資源能夠執(zhí)行的處理的HDL程序,切換為依照對(duì)硬件資源的控制來(lái)控制硬件資源的第一控制和依照對(duì)硬件資源的控制來(lái)執(zhí)行變更后的HDL程序的第二控制中的某一個(gè)控制。因此,在切換為第二控制的情況下,能夠?qū)ψ兏擞布Y源能夠執(zhí)行的處理而得到的動(dòng)作進(jìn)行仿真。其結(jié)果是能夠提供一種能夠不變更硬件資源而再現(xiàn)變更了硬件資源的動(dòng)作的狀態(tài)的圖像處理裝置。
優(yōu)選為有多個(gè)硬件資源,圖像處理裝置還具備:資源確定單元,確定由用戶從多個(gè)硬件資源中選擇出的硬件資源;以及程序獲取單元,獲取與確定出的硬件資源對(duì)應(yīng)的HDL程序,變更單元根據(jù)由用戶作出的指示來(lái)變更獲取到的HDL程序,切換單元針對(duì)確定出的硬件資源切換為第一控制和第二控制中的某一個(gè)控制。
根據(jù)該方案,能夠在根據(jù)由用戶作出的指示進(jìn)行了變更的狀態(tài)下再現(xiàn)由用戶從多個(gè)硬件資源中選擇出的硬件資源的動(dòng)作。
優(yōu)選變更單元包括延長(zhǎng)命令追加單元,該延長(zhǎng)命令追加單元追加使從硬件資源執(zhí)行處理起至輸出結(jié)果為止的響應(yīng)時(shí)間延長(zhǎng)的命令。
根據(jù)該方案,能夠在延長(zhǎng)了從硬件資源執(zhí)行處理起至輸出結(jié)果為止的響應(yīng)時(shí)間的狀態(tài)下再現(xiàn)硬件的動(dòng)作,所以能夠提高在從硬件資源執(zhí)行處理起至輸出結(jié)果為止的期間所發(fā)生的問(wèn)題的發(fā)生頻度。
優(yōu)選變更單元包括參數(shù)檢查命令追加單元,該參數(shù)檢查命令追加單元追加對(duì)為了硬件資源執(zhí)行處理而從客驅(qū)動(dòng)單元受理的參數(shù)進(jìn)行檢查的命令。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于柯尼卡美能達(dá)株式會(huì)社,未經(jīng)柯尼卡美能達(dá)株式會(huì)社許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201710483109.9/2.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 彩色圖像和單色圖像的圖像處理
- 圖像編碼/圖像解碼方法以及圖像編碼/圖像解碼裝置
- 圖像處理裝置、圖像形成裝置、圖像讀取裝置、圖像處理方法
- 圖像解密方法、圖像加密方法、圖像解密裝置、圖像加密裝置、圖像解密程序以及圖像加密程序
- 圖像解密方法、圖像加密方法、圖像解密裝置、圖像加密裝置、圖像解密程序以及圖像加密程序
- 圖像編碼方法、圖像解碼方法、圖像編碼裝置、圖像解碼裝置、圖像編碼程序以及圖像解碼程序
- 圖像編碼方法、圖像解碼方法、圖像編碼裝置、圖像解碼裝置、圖像編碼程序、以及圖像解碼程序
- 圖像形成設(shè)備、圖像形成系統(tǒng)和圖像形成方法
- 圖像編碼裝置、圖像編碼方法、圖像編碼程序、圖像解碼裝置、圖像解碼方法及圖像解碼程序
- 圖像編碼裝置、圖像編碼方法、圖像編碼程序、圖像解碼裝置、圖像解碼方法及圖像解碼程序
- 調(diào)試系統(tǒng)、調(diào)試方法和調(diào)試控制方法
- 一種終端調(diào)試方法和裝置
- 設(shè)備自動(dòng)工程調(diào)試方法、裝置、系統(tǒng)和計(jì)算機(jī)設(shè)備
- 基于串口的遠(yuǎn)程設(shè)備調(diào)試系統(tǒng)及方法
- 一種安卓系統(tǒng)動(dòng)態(tài)調(diào)試的方法及系統(tǒng)
- 調(diào)試裝置和遠(yuǎn)程調(diào)試系統(tǒng)
- 一種調(diào)試方法、裝置及系統(tǒng)
- 一種應(yīng)用程序開發(fā)的調(diào)試系統(tǒng)及方法
- 樓宇設(shè)備的異地調(diào)試控制方法、裝置和計(jì)算機(jī)設(shè)備
- 一種芯片調(diào)試系統(tǒng)及芯片調(diào)試方法





